How to make "Aji no Juban" Tanmen
Introduction
This is a recipe that recreates the tanmen from Aji Aji no Juban that is representative of Higashi-Nakano, Tokyo.
Aji no Juban 's tanmen is made with a clear, mild-tasting soup stock topped with plenty of vegetables, and is served with thick noodles. The soup is well-seasoned with Garlic and sesame oil, giving it a mild yet punchy flavor. Umami of the vegetables is also well-infused, so it feels a little thick, but that goes perfectly with the soup! It's easy to see why this bowl is loved by people of all ages.

How to make "Aji no Juban" Tanmen
Aji no Juban Ingredients
【soup】
・Water・・・6ℓ
・Pig's feet・・・1kg
・Chicken bones...1kg
・ [Commercial Use] Chicken and Pork White Soup (CP-M6)...2kg
・ Onion ・・・300g
・Carrot... 200g
・ Garlic ・・・100g
・Long onion・・・・100g
[Tanmen]
・Soup・・・300ml
[Tanmen vegetables]
・Sesame oil...20g
・Pork...20g
・Chinese cabbage...20g
・Carrot...5g
・Bamboo shoots...10g
・ Wood Ear Mushroom ・・・ 10g
・Chinese chives...10g
・ Umami seasoning・・・1g
・ Garlic...1g
=Completed amount...1 serving
How to make Aji no Juban
- To make the soup, grill the vegetables and then simmer all the ingredients over medium heat for an hour.
- Once the broth comes out, it will become the base of the flavor. [For commercial use] Add the frozen chicken and pork white soup (CP-M6) and dissolve over low heat.
- Garlic the tanmen vegetables, lightly fry the sesame oil, garlic, and pork, then add the vegetables in that order. Then add the soup from step 2.

History and origins
Aji no Juban is a Ramen shop that was founded in 1956. The name "Aji no Juban" comes from the fact that the founder was from Azabu Juban. It is a long-established Ramen shop frequented by many famous people, including the famous sumo wrestlers Wakanohana and Takanohana, who were regulars when they were students. It is famous for its tanmen, jajangmyeon, and gyoza.
